Como instalar .NET CORE (DOTNET) no Ubuntu 22.04

Como instalar .NET CORE (DOTNET) no Ubuntu 22.04

Microsoft .Núcleo líquido é uma estrutura de software gratuita e de código aberto projetado para manter o Linux e o MacOS em mente. É um sucessor de plataforma cruzada para .Framework Net disponível para sistemas Linux, MacOS e Windows ... Net Core 6 é uma versão LTR que suportará os próximos 3 anos. Ele também suporta recarga a quente e melhor integração do Git com o Visual Studio 2022.

O Ubuntu 22.04 usuários só podem instalar .NET CORE 6.0. Não suporta .Net Core 3.1 ou 2.0 Como o distro suporta apenas OpenSSL 3.

Os desenvolvedores devem instalar o .Net Core SDK em seu sistema e o servidor de estadiamento ou produção precisa do .Apenas tempo de execução do núcleo líquido. Este tutorial passa pela instalação do .Núcleo líquido no Ubuntu 22.04 LTS Linux System. Você pode instalar .Líquido sdk ou configure o ambiente de tempo de execução em seu sistema.

Etapa 1 - Ativar Microsoft PPA

Primeiro de tudo, ative o repositório da Microsoft APT em nossos sistemas Ubuntu. A equipe da Microsoft fornece um pacote Debian para configurar o PPA no sistema Ubuntu.

Abra um terminal no seu sistema Ubuntu e configure o Microsoft PPA executando os seguintes comandos:

wget https: // pacotes.Microsoft.com/config/ubuntu/22.04/Packages-Microsoft-Prod.Deb  sudo dpkg -i packages-microsoft-produ.Deb  

Comandos acima criarão um /etc/apt/fontes.lista.D/Microsoft-Prod.lista Arquive em seu sistema com a configuração necessária.

Vamos começar o .Instalação do núcleo líquido no sistema Ubuntu.

Etapa 2 - Instalando .Net Core SDK no Ubuntu

.NET CORE SDK é o kit de desenvolvimento de software usado para desenvolver aplicativos. Se você vai criar um aplicativo ou fazer alterações em um aplicativo existente, você precisará de um .pacote sdk líquido do núcleo no seu sistema.

Para instalar .NET CORE SDK no Ubuntu 22.04 Sistema LTS, execute os seguintes comandos:

sudo apt install apt-transport-https  Atualização do sudo apt  sudo apt install dotnet-sdk-6.0  

Pressione “Y” para qualquer entrada solicitada pelo instalador.

É isso. Você instalou com sucesso .Net Core SDK no seu sistema Ubuntu.

Etapa 3 - Instalando .Tempo de execução do núcleo líquido no Ubuntu

.Núcleo líquido É necessário tempo de execução para o sistema, onde você só precisa executar o aplicativo. Por exemplo, ambientes de produção ou estadiamento são necessários para executar apenas aplicativos.

Para instalar .Tempo de execução líquido do núcleo apenas no Ubuntu 22.04 Sistema LTS, Tipo:

sudo apt install apt-transport-https  Atualização do sudo apt  sudo apt install dotnet-runtime-6.0  

Pressione “Y” para qualquer entrada solicitada pelo instalador.

É isso. Você instalou com sucesso o .Tempo de execução do núcleo líquido em seu sistema Ubuntu.

Etapa 4 - Verifique .Versão Net Core

Você pode usar o utilitário de linha de comando dotnet para verificar a versão instalada do .Núcleo líquido em seu sistema. Para verificar a versão do DotNet, digite:

DOTNET --VERSION 

Saída:
Verificando .Versão Net Core

Etapa 5 - (Opcional) Crie um aplicativo de amostra

Vamos criar um aplicativo de amostra com o núcleo dotnet no seu sistema Ubuntu. Crie um novo aplicativo de console com o comando:

DOTNET NOVO CONSOL 

Isso criará um .Aplicação Net Core em seu sistema. Isso criará um diretório nomeado "Olá Mundo" Sob o diretório atual. Você pode mudar para este diretório e começar a trabalhar em seu aplicativo.

CD Helloworld 

Faça suas alterações no aplicativo e execute o comando abaixo para executar este aplicativo.

DOTNET RUN 

Você verá a seguinte saída como resultado.

Correndo .Aplicação Net Core Helloworld

Remova ou desinstale .Núcleo líquido no Ubuntu

No caso, o .O núcleo líquido não é mais necessário no seu sistema. Você pode desinstalá -lo do sistema com os seguintes comandos.

sudo apt remove-purge dotnet-sdk-6.0 dotnet-runtime-6.0  

Além disso, remova os pacotes não utilizados instalados como dependências:

sudo apt automatizando automaticamente  

Conclusão

Neste tutorial, você aprendeu a instalar .Net Core SDK e Runtime em um Ubuntu 22.04 LTS (Sistema de Linux Linfish) LTS (Jellyfish). Agora, você pode instalar o código do Visual Studio ou o editor de texto sublime em seus sistemas de desktop ubuntu.